Russell Wilson roundly booed by Seahawks fans in return to Seattle with Broncos

Russell Wilson delivered nine winning seasons, eight playoff appearances, nine playoff wins, two NFC championships and a Super Bowl victory during his 10-year tenure with the Seattle Seahawks. It was easily the most prosperous run in the 47-season history of the franchise. Russell Wilson is 2nd-highest paid player per year in NFL after Broncos extension

The Denver Broncos are all-in on quarterback Russell Wilson. Denver traded for Wilson and a few months later, just before Wilson takes his first snaps with his new team, the Broncos paid him a fortune. Denver and Wilson agreed to an extension worth $245 million in new money, according to ESPN’s Adam Schefter. The extension is for five years and includes $165 million guaranteed. Broncos announce sale to Walton-Penner group for $4.65 billion

The Walmart family is officially taking over the Denver Broncos. Broncos, not Cowboys, reportedly sign DE Randy Gregory

Defensive end Randy Gregory intends to sign a contract with the Denver Broncos, not the Dallas Cowboys, according to Yahoo Sports’ Charles Robinson. It was reported earlier Tuesday that Gregory was signing a five-year, $70 million extension with the Cowboys, but that deal fell apart when the Cowboys included language in the contract that Gregory didn’t like.
